+Integral Personal Computer (HP9807A)
+Hewlett-Packard, 1985
+
+This is a portable mains-powered UNIX workstation computer system produced by Hewlett-Packard and launched in 1985
+Basic hardware specs are....
+- 68000 CPU at 7.96MHz
+- 9" amber electro-luminescent display with a resolution of 255*512 pixels or up to 85 characters x 31 lines (default=80*24) with
+ dedicated 32Kb display memory
+- Internal 3.5" floppy disk drive with the following specification....
+ Encoding: Double Density HP MFM Format
+ Rotational speed: 600 RPM
+ Transfer speed: 62.5kB/second
+ Capacity: 709Kb (709632 bytes)
+ Bytes per sector: 512
+ Sectors per track: 9
+ Total tracks per surface: 80, Available: 77, Spare: 2, Wear: 1
+ Surfaces: 2
+ Interleave: 1
+- HP ThinkJet ink-jet printer integrated into the top of the case. This is a modified HP2225B Thinkjet printer
+- 90-key detachable keyboard
+- ROM: up to 512Kb standard and an additional 512Kb of option ROM
+- RAM: 512Kb, arranged as 256Kbx16. RAM is expandable externally to 7Mb
+- Real Time Clock
+- Speaker
+- External I/O bus with two I/O ports for interfaces and memory modules. Expandable to maximum 10 ports with two 5-port Bus Expander Modules
+- HP-IB (IEEE-488) bus
+- Runs the HP-UX Operating System III or System V (in ROM)

+Notes:
+ 68000 - 68000 CPU at U7. Clock input 7.96MHz [15.92/2] (DIP64)
+ LS74 - 74LS74 at U2 provides system clock dividers /4 /2
+ MB81256 - Fujitsu MB81256 256Kx1 DRAM. Total RAM 512Kx8/256Kx16. HP part# 1818-3308. U20-U35 (DIP16)
+ TMS4500 - Texas Instruments TMS4500A DRAM Controller at U4. Clock input 3.98MHz [15.92/4] (DIP40)
+ U58 - HP-HIL Keyboard Interface 'Cerberus'. Clock input on pin 24 is unknown (DIP24)
+ U60 - Unknown IC used as an interrupt encoder. Possibly a logic chip? (DIP20)
+ 555 - 555 Timer
+ J1/J2 - Connectors joining to LOGIC B PCA (logic A to logic B bus)
+ J3/J4 - Connectors for ROM board
+ J5 - Power input connector from power supply PCB
+ J6 - 64-pin external I/O bus. This is connected to the I/O backplane PCB mounted at the rear of the case using a ribbon cable
+ J7 - 10 pin connector. Labelled on schematics as LOOP0 In/Out and LOOP1 In/Out. Connected to 'Cerberus' IC. Possibly for more input devices?

+Notes:
+ GPU - GPU (Graphics Processor) at U1. Clock input 3MHz [24/8]. VSync on pin 45, HSync on pin 46 (DIP48)
+ 16Kx4 - 16Kx4 DRAM, organised as 32Kx8bit/16Kx16bit at U3, U4, U5 & U6. Chip type unknown, likely Fujitsu MB81416 (DIP18)
+ WD2797 - WD2797 Floppy Disk Controller at U18. Clock input 2MHz [24/2/3/2] (DIP40)
+ HP-IL(1) - HP-IL 1LJ7-0015 'Saturn' Thinkjet Printer Controller IC at U28. Clock input 3MHz on pin 9 [24/8] (DIP48)
+ HP-IL(2) - HP-IL Interface IC at U31. Clock input 2MHz on pin 22 [24/2/3/2] (DIP28)
+ 1Kb - 1Kb RAM at U27 for printer buffer (DIP28, type unknown, very old, with only DATA0,1,2,3, C/D and DIN,DOUT)
+ ROM - 16Kb (2Kx8) Some kind of very early DIP28 PROM/ROM? Same pinout as 1Kb RAM above. Holds the character font table for the printer
+ Four versions of this ROM exist, one each for Japan/Arabic/Hebrew and one for all other regions
+ NS58167A - National Semiconductor NS58167A Clock Controller RTC at U44. Clock input 32.768kHz (DIP24)
+ LM358 - National Semiconductor LM358 Operational Amplifier at U40 (DIP8)
+ LM393 - Texas Instruments LM393 Dual Comparator (DIP8)
+ BT1 - 3v lithium battery
+ COP452 - National Semiconductor COP452 Speaker Controller at U39. Clock input 2MHz [24/2/3/2]. This IC provides programmable square wave output from 100Hz to 5000Hz (DIP14)
+ TMS9914 - Texas Instruments TMS9914 General Purpose Interface Bus Adapter at U41. Clock input 4MHz [24/2/3] (DIP40)
+ 75160 - National Semiconductor DS75160A IEEE-488 General Purpose Interface Bus Transceiver at U42 (DIP20)
+ 75162 - National Semiconductor DS75162A IEEE-488 General Purpose Interface Bus Transceiver at U43 (DIP22)
+ LS193 - 74LS193 at U9 provides the main system clock dividers /8 /4 /2 (24MHz -> 12MHz, 6MHz, 3MHz). This is also the source of the 6MHz video clock on connector J1
+ LS161 - 74LS161 at U46. Takes 12MHz clock input on pin 2 and outputs 4MHz on pin 13 (i.e. /3). This is the clock source for the TMS9914
+ LS74 - LS74 at U16. Takes output of 4MHz from LS161 at U46 and outputs 2MHz on pin 5 (i.e. /2). This is the source of the 2MHz clocks
+ J1 - Connector joining to video display assembly
+ J2 - Connector joining to floppy drive
+ J3 - Connector joining to printer front switch panel assembly (ADV/CONT/FF/ATTN)
+ J4 - Connector joining to printer out of paper switch connected to ATTN
+ J5 - Connector joining to printer carriage motor
+ J6 - Connector joining to printer mechanism assembly including paper motor
+ J7 - Connector joining to printer printhead
+ J8 - Connector joining to HO?E switch (? ~ M, text unreadable on schems)
+ J9 - Connector for ?
+ J10/J11 - Connectors joining to LOGIC A PCA (logic A to logic B bus)
+ J12 - Power input connector from power supply PCB
+ J14 - Fan connector

+Physical Memory Map
+===================
+000000-07FFFF - Internal ROM (Operating System PCA 512Kb)
+080000-0FFFFF - Internal ROM (Option ROM PCA 512Kb)
+100000-4FFFFF - External ROM modules (up to 4Mb)
+500000-5FFFFF - Reserved 1Mb
+600000-6FFFFF - Internal I/O 1Mb
+
+ Address Port Use
+ -------------------------
+ 600000-60FFFF 0 MMU
+ 610000-61FFFF 1 Disk Drive
+ 620000-62FFFF 2 Display
+ 630000-63FFFF 3 HP-IB
+ 640000-64FFFF 4 RTC
+ 650000-65FFFF 5 Printer
+ 660000-66FFFF 6 Keyboard
+ 670000-67FFFF 7 Speaker
+ 680000-68FFFF 8 Reserved
+ 690000-69FFFF 9 Reserved
+ 6A0000-6AFFFF 10 Reserved
+ 6B0000-6BFFFF 11 Reserved
+ 6C0000-6CFFFF 12 Reserved
+ 6D0000-6DFFFF 13 Reserved
+ 6E0000-6EFFFF 14 Reserved
+ 6F0000-6FFFFF 15 Reserved
+
+700000-7FFFFF - External I/O 1Mb
+
+ Address Port Use
+ -------------------------
+ 700000-70FFFF 16 Mainframe Port A
+ 710000-71FFFF 17 Mainframe Port B
+ 720000-72FFFF 18 Bus Expander Port A1
+ 730000-73FFFF 19 Bus Expander Port A2
+ 740000-74FFFF 20 Bus Expander Port A3
+ 750000-75FFFF 21 Bus Expander Port A4
+ 760000-76FFFF 22 Bus Expander Port A5
+ 770000-77FFFF 23 Reserved
+ 780000-78FFFF 24 Reserved
+ 790000-79FFFF 25 Reserved
+ 7A0000-7AFFFF 26 Bus Expander Port B1
+ 7B0000-7BFFFF 27 Bus Expander Port B2
+ 7C0000-7CFFFF 28 Bus Expander Port B3
+ 7D0000-7DFFFF 29 Bus Expander Port B4
+ 7E0000-7EFFFF 30 Bus Expander Port B5
+ 7F0000-7FFFFF 31 Reserved
+
+800000-EFFFFF - External RAM modules (up to 7Mb)
+F00000-F7FFFF - Internal RAM 512Kb
+F80000-FFFFFF - Reserved 512Kb
+
+Access to 800000-FFFFFF can be remapped by the MMU registers.
+
+
+Interrupts
+----------
+High Priority 7 - Soft reset from keyboard (NMI)
+ /\ 6 - RTC or NBIR3 (external I/O)
+ || 5 - Disc Drive or NBIR2 (external I/O)
+ || 4 - GPU or NBIR1 (external I/O)
+ || 3 - HP-IB, printer or NBIR0 (external I/O)
+ \/ 2 - HP-HIL devices (keyboard/mouse)
+Low Priority 1 - RTC
+
+Note external interrupt lines NBIR0 to NBIR3 can be asserted by an interface connected to the external I/O port
